Noank, New London County

Nestled in the eastern coastline of the United States, the village of Noank in New London County, Connecticut, offers a charming and scenic escape for residents and visitors alike. Known for its picturesque views, historic architecture, and a strong sense of community, Noank has become a popular destination for those looking to experience the beauty and tranquility of this coastal region.

Located on the eastern shore of the Mystic River, Noank is just a short drive from the larger city of New London. With its proximity to the water, the village boasts stunning views of Long Island Sound and boasts a rich maritime history. In fact, the heart of Noank is its harbor, which welcomes a fleet of fishing and recreational boats. Visitors can stroll along the harbor promenade and watch as fishermen bring in their daily catch, or take a ride on one of the chartered fishing boats for an unforgettable experience on the open water.

In addition to its maritime heritage, Noank is also known for its historical charm. The village is home to many well-preserved historic buildings, some dating back to the 18th century. This includes the Noank Baptist Church, built in 1847, which showcases the traditional New England architectural style. Other notable landmarks include the Noank Historical Society, which offers a glimpse into the area’s past through its exhibits and artifacts.

For nature enthusiasts, Noank offers plenty of outdoor activities to enjoy. The surrounding area is dotted with parks and nature reserves, providing ample opportunities for hiking, bird-watching, and picnicking. Haley Farm State Park, located just a short distance from Noank, is a popular destination for nature lovers, boasting scenic trails that wind through forests and along the shoreline. Visitors can also explore Barn Island Wildlife Management Area, which encompasses over 1,000 acres of diverse habitats, including salt marshes, woodlands, and open fields.

Noank is not just a place for quiet relaxation, but also a hub for culinary delights. The village is renowned for its seafood, with several restaurants offering fresh and delicious seafood dishes. From classic New England clam chowder to succulent lobster rolls, visitors can delight their taste buds with a delectable selection of local catches.

For those looking to explore the wider area, Noank is conveniently located near several other notable destinations. Mystic, which is just a short drive away, is a charming waterfront town famous for its Mystic Seaport Museum and Mystic Aquarium. Visitors can step back in time to learn about the region’s seafaring history or marvel at a variety of marine species. Additionally, nearby Groton offers the Submarine Force Museum, where visitors can explore a collection of historic submarines and learn about the US Navy’s submarine force.
